The Sufficient (Vol 6) · Hadith 2176 (#Ḥadīth #11)
Chapter 41 | Al-Kohl (The Eye Powder): Antimony
عِدَّةٌ مِنْ أَصْحَابِنَا ع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 أَبِي عَبْدِ اللَّهِ عَنِ ابْنِ فَضَّالٍ عَنِ ابْنِ الْقَدَّاحِ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 اللَّهِ ( عليه السلام ) قَالَ قَالَ أَمِيرُ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 ( صلوات الله عليه ) مَنِ اكْتَحَلَ فَلْيُوتِرْ وَ مَنْ فَعَلَ فَقَدْ أَحْسَنَ وَ مَنْ لَمْ يَفْعَلْ فَلَا بَأْسَ .
11. A number of our people have narrated from Ahmad ibn abu ‘Abd Allah from ibn Faddal from ibn al-Qaddah who has said the following: “Abu ‘Abd Allah , has said that ’Amir al-Mu’minin has said, ‘If one applies eye powder, he must do it once because it is good; and if he did not do so it is not harmful.’”
